Future research directions

• Studies of survival of excited nuclei in the
actinide region with SaSSYER.
• Study the complexation of transactinide
homologs with cryptands and crown ethers
in "online" experiments
• Studying beta-delayed proton decays of
pure Fermi Transitions with TAMUTrap
• Nuclear astrophysics with stable and rare
isotope beams.
• Structure of light exotic nuclei.
• Clustering phenomena in light and medium
mass nuclei.
• Studies of the EOS and Esym
• Pionic Fusion
• Superallowed decay studies on Tz=-1
nuclei
• GMR as probe of structure and asymmetry
• Develop and apply nuclear theory of HI rxn
and GR to determine the next generation
energy density functional for nuclei.
